大学生电子商务专业网站设计_手工搭建Magento电子商务网站(Linux)

大学生电子商务专业网站设计,手工搭建Magento电子商务网站(Linux)。通过学习Linux操作系统,掌握Magento的安装、配置和优化,提升网站性能。

手工搭建Magento电子商务网站(Linux)

大学生电子商务专业网站设计_手工搭建Magento电子商务网站(Linux)
(图片来源网络,侵删)

导言

在当今数字化时代,电子商务网站已成为企业与消费者之间沟通的重要桥梁,对于电子商务专业的大学生来说,掌握如何设计和搭建一个专业的电子商务网站是一项重要的技能,本文将指导你通过手动安装和配置Magento平台,来搭建一个功能齐全的电子商务网站。

系统要求与准备

操作系统

Linux发行版(如Ubuntu, CentOS等)

网络环境

稳定的互联网连接

域名及SSL证书(可选)

大学生电子商务专业网站设计_手工搭建Magento电子商务网站(Linux)
(图片来源网络,侵删)

软件依赖

PHP版本7.0以上

MySQL或MariaDB数据库

Apache或Nginx Web服务器

Composer依赖管理工具

Git版本控制系统

Magento安装步骤

第一步:环境配置

大学生电子商务专业网站设计_手工搭建Magento电子商务网站(Linux)
(图片来源网络,侵删)

1、安装Apache/Nginx:选择其中一个作为Web服务器,并进行安装配置。

2、安装PHP:确保安装了Magento所需的PHP版本及扩展。

3、安装MySQL/MariaDB:设置数据库并创建Magento所需数据库和用户。

4、安装Composer和Git:这两个工具将用于管理和下载Magento代码。

第二步:下载并安装Magento

1、克隆Magento仓库:使用Git克隆Magento最新版本的代码库。

“`

git clone https://github.com/magento/magento2.git

“`

2、进入目录并安装

“`

cd magento2

composer install

“`

3、生成必要的文件

“`

php bin/magento setup:di:compile

php bin/magento setup:staticcontent:deploy

“`

第三步:数据库配置与网站访问

1、配置app/etc/env.php:编辑该文件,填入数据库信息。

2、创建管理员账户:首次访问网站时创建。

3、访问网站:在浏览器中输入服务器地址查看网站。

第四步:主题与插件安装

1、选择主题:根据需求选择合适的Magento主题。

2、安装插件:通过Magento市场或自定义开发添加功能插件。

第五步:测试与优化

1、功能测试:确保所有页面和功能按预期工作。

2、性能优化:对网站进行速度和安全性优化。

相关问题与解答

Q1: 在安装Magento时遇到了权限问题,怎么办?

A1: 确保你在执行Magento命令时使用了正确的权限,你可能需要给予特定的文件夹写入权限,

“`

chmod R 755 <magento_directory>

“`

或者使用sudo命令以超级用户权限运行。

Q2: Magento网站加载速度慢,有什么优化建议?

A2: 优化Magento网站的加载速度可以通过多种方式实现,包括但不限于:

启用缓存:利用Magento内置的缓存机制减少加载时间。

图片优化:压缩图片大小,使用懒加载技术。

使用CDN:部署内容分发网络(CDN)以提高静态内容的加载速度。

代码和查询优化:确保代码干净且高效,优化数据库查询。

使用高性能的主机服务:考虑升级你的Web服务器硬件或选择更优质的托管服务。

【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!

(0)
热舞的头像热舞
上一篇 2024-07-07 16:55
下一篇 2024-07-07 17:00

相关推荐

  • Quartus报错代码119013究竟是什么,要怎么解决?

    在使用Intel Quartus Prime软件进行FPGA开发的过程中,开发者时常会遇到各种编译错误,错误代码119013是尤为常见且让初学者感到困惑的一个,该错误提示信息通常为:“Error (119013): Can’t resolve multiple constant drivers for net……

    2025-10-16
    0018
  • 在MySQL数据库中,哪些日志和文件占据了RDS磁盘空间?

    MySQL数据库文件目录中占用RDS磁盘空间的日志及文件主要包括:数据文件、日志文件、临时文件、二进制日志文件、慢查询日志文件、错误日志文件等。

    2024-09-05
    0011
  • 龙之谷2服务器开启时间究竟定于何时?

    《龙之谷2》的服务器开启时间取决于游戏开发商或运营商的具体安排,通常会在游戏测试、正式发布或维护更新时进行。为了获取最准确的开服信息,建议关注官方公告、社交媒体更新或相关游戏论坛的消息。

    2024-07-18
    008
  • 如何高效地实现MySQL数据库与Hive数据库之间的数据导入导出?

    要将MySQL数据库的数据导入到Hive,首先需要将MySQL数据导出为CSV或JSON格式的文件,然后在Hive中创建相应的表并加载数据。具体操作如下:,,1. 从MySQL导出数据:,,“bash,mysqldump u 用户名 p compatible=csv fieldsenclosedby='”‘ fieldsterminatedby=’,’ tab=/path/to/output/directory 数据库名 表名,`,,2. 将数据导入到Hive:,,`sql,CREATE EXTERNAL TABLE IF NOT EXISTS hive_table_name,(column1 data_type1, column2 data_type2, …),ROW FORMAT DELIMITED,FIELDS TERMINATED BY ‘,’,LINES TERMINATED BY ‘,’,STORED AS TEXTFILE,LOCATION ‘/path/to/hive/warehouse/directory/hive_table_name’;,`,,3. 将导出的CSV文件上传到HDFS:,,`bash,hadoop fs put /path/to/output/directory/table_name.txt /path/to/hive/warehouse/directory/hive_table_name,`,,4. 在Hive中加载数据:,,`sql,LOAD DATA INPATH ‘/path/to/hive/warehouse/directory/hive_table_name’ INTO TABLE hive_table_name;,“

    2024-08-09
    009

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

广告合作

QQ:14239236

在线咨询: QQ交谈

邮件:asy@cxas.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信